ICD-10 diagnosis code

L81.4 Other melanin hyperpigmentation

This page in Swedish

L81.4 is the ICD-10 code for Other melanin hyperpigmentation. It is a four-character subcategory of L81 (Other disorders of pigmentation), the most specific level in the WHO edition. It belongs to the block L80–L99 (Other disorders of the skin and subcutaneous tissue) in Chapter XII, Diseases of the skin and subcutaneous tissue.

What L81.4 includes

Conditions and terms that are coded here.

  • Lentigo

L81.4 in national editions

Countries report with their own edition of ICD-10. Most keep the WHO code and add more specific codes beneath it.

SwedenICD-10-SE

L81.4Annan melaninhyperpigmentering

  • L81.4ALentigo
  • L81.4BMelanosis dorsalis
  • L81.4CPigmented cosmetic dermatitis
  • L81.4DPUVA-Lentigines
  • L81.4ERiehls melanos
  • L81.4WAnnan och ospecificerad melaninhyperpigmentering
NorwayICD-10-NO

L81.4Annen melaninhyperpigmentering

DenmarkICD-10-DK

DL814Anden form for melaninhyperpigmentering

  • DL814AHypermelanosis UNS
  • DL814BMelanosis cutis
  • DL814CNævoid hypermelanose
  • DL814DLinear and whorled hypermelanosis
  • DL814ELentigo
  • DL814FLentiginosis
  • DL814GMelanoderma
